The electric potential at the centre of a charged hollow metal sphere is:

Same as that on the surface
- Inside a Charged Conductor: For a hollow metal sphere (or any conductor) in electrostatic equilibrium, the electric field (E) is zero everywhere inside.
- Relation between E and V: E=−drdV. If E=0, then V must be constant.
- Boundary Condition: The potential must be continuous across the surface.
- Conclusion: Since the potential is constant inside and equal to the surface value, the potential at the center is the same as that on the surface.
